
Rishabh Pant, a talented but inconsistent wicket-keeper batsman, is known for his aggressive, risk-taking style. This approach has led to both brilliant performances and frustrating errors, such as a recent 'brain-fade' stroke during the South Africa Test series. Consequently, Pant missed the T20 World Cup and faces uncertainty regarding his ODI place. His style mirrors that of pioneering aviators and other young, ultra-aggressive cricketers globally, highlighting the high-stakes nature of such batting.
